The opposition TDP is not leaving any stone unturned to capture the upcoming Tirupati by-election. Days after Nara Lokesh campaigned for the party, TDP chief, former Andhra Pradesh CM Chandrababu Naidu held an election rally on April 12.

Tension gripped the Krishnapuram area when stones were reportedly pelted at the election rally when Chandrababu Naidu was addressing the rally.

Chandrababu Naidu alleged that stones were pelted at him. He even claimed that two other party activists were also injured at the rally after some miscreants pelted stones on Monday.

Alleging a political conspiracy behind the attack, Chandrababu Naidu sat on the road in the area. He urged the Election Commission to respond to the incident and take action against the people responsible for this.

The Election Commission should look into the incident and take the required action. If a person with a Z-plus protectee can't be protected. What will be the situation of the common people in the state, Chandrababu Naidu said.

The Police officials tried to bring the situation under control by trying to placate him. After the Additional Superintendent of Police assured him that those who are responsible for this will be arrested, Chandrababu Naidu left the spot.

While the TDP blamed the ruling YSRCP for the stone-pelting incident, the ruling party rubbished the allegations and said the TDP is playing the drama to gain public sympathy ahead of Tirupati polls.
